The Rtas 'Vadum in crashed Flood ship easter egg can be found on the Halo 3 level Floodgate.

When you jump down the hole to get into the Flood ship that crashed, there will be a few dead Ultra Elites lying around. Sometimes one or more will have Rtas 'Vadum's face, in which two mandibles are missing. You can get it infected, too, if you push it down the hole and release some Infection Forms. When he turns into a Flood Combat Form, his armor remains silver, but changes to default blue, like most Flood, when the body is destroyed.
